Job Summary & Qualifications

The Clinical Research Coordinator II is responsible for coordinating multiple research protocols; serving as a liaison with local investigators and research personnel; and acting as a central resource for assigned research projects. The individual in this role offers a significant contribution to the development of processes, tools, and training necessary to maintain site compliance and patient safety.

What qualifications you will need:

  • 2-3 years of Clinical Research Coordinator experience required

  • Bachelor’s Degree required

  • Certified Clinical Research Coordinator (ACRP or CCRP) preferred

  • Knowledge of federal regulations, good clinical practices (GCP), and medical & research terminology

  • Computer skills, including use of clinical trial database, electronic data capture, and MS Word or Excel

  • The ability to communicate and work effectively with a diverse team of professionals

  • The ability to work independently in a fast pace environment with minimal supervision at off-site facilities

What you will do in this role:

  • Perform routine operational activities for multiple research protocols

  • Liaise between site research personnel, industry sponsors, and Supervisor

  • Collaborate closely with various site departments/teams, including finance, relevant hospital administrative representatives, and the local IRB, if applicable

  • Coordinate schedule of assessments from initial submission of feasibility until study closeout

  • Coordinate submission and approval for the Site’s Facility Review Committee, if applicable

  • Provide awareness of research protocols to appropriate site-level personnel, including physicians, nurses, clinical staff, and administrators

  • Document all specific tasks required by the protocol (i.e. medication forms, quality of life questionnaires, neuro exams, vital signs sheets, times of lab draws, etc.)

  • Accurately perform/calculate and documents the BSA, mRS, NIHSS, STS risk score, or any other approved CRC task, as needed per protocol

  • Document all patient, staff, and sponsor correspondence, including follow-up encounters, adverse events, interventions, pharmacy dispensations, and patient phone calls

  • Ensure follow-up appointments, imaging, or any related procedures are scheduled correctly according to protocol requirements

  • Accurately complete all data requests (including queries) and submit with source documentation within the timeframe specified in the SOP

  • Re-consent patients in a timely manner and document process appropriately

  • Support study team in mitigating risks and optimizing site compliance

  • Work with site personnel and local investigators to assess site feasibility and performance

  • Regularly meet with physicians and administrators, when applicable, to assess study performance and investigator satisfaction

  • Collaborate with other departments (non-invasive, finance, laboratory, etc.) to develop and implement processes in support of the research activities

  • Assist with providing a research update during Site Administrative meetings (Section meetings, Site Service Line meetings, etc.)

  • Able to guide research team members on the management of non-compliant data and/or study activities

  • Monitor patient enrollment at the site through weekly reports, and reports results to Supervisor

  • Facilitate continuing education and training to investigators, as applicable
